[QUOTE="Jimmy Disco T, post: 6349576, member: 6749529"] A brief introduction to try and garner interest... [I][FONT=Verdana, sans-serif]The glory days of the Elves and Dwarves are long gone, leaving only mysterious ruins, dungeons,and ancient magic artifacts as a reminder of ages long gone. The descendants of these once mighty empires have withdrawn to their forests and mountains, leaving just the outcasts, wanderers and occasional traders to maintain contact with the rest of the world. [/FONT][/I] [I][FONT=Verdana]Human settlements dot the landscape - isolated villages, bustling city-states, seaports and everything in between. Slowly the humans are pushing back the boundaries of the monster-filled lands and reclaiming them for civilization, much as the Elves and Dwarves did before them. The Halfling people, once content to stay within their safe and hidden vales and dens, are becoming an increasingly common sight across the land.[/FONT][/I] [I][FONT=Verdana] Adventurers from all races seek wealth, fortune, magic and power slaying monsters beyond the capabilities of simple guardsmen, delving into ancient dungeons and recovering long lost magic, seeking glory and fame through epic deeds. [/FONT][/I] [I][FONT=Verdana]The town of Northwatch lies on the coast, at the edges of Human civilization. Somewhat isolated, it relies upon sea trade and thelong and dangerous road to the south to maintain links with othersettlements. A crumbling stone wall and the Town Guard defend against the beasts and monsters that lurk in the surrounding woods. Ancient ruins, Dwarven dungeons and Elven standing stones are found in the local area, the subject of endless alehouse rumours. [/FONT][/I] [I][FONT=Verdana]You and your companions find yourself in the back of a rickety wagon,half full with sacks of grain and other goods, pulled by a tired looking pony and driven by a disinterested Dwarven trader. You are on your way to Northwatch in search of fortune and adventure. You have heard that the town's local office of the Merchant's League is seeking help for an unusual problem, and they happen to be a very wealthy organisation indeed... [/FONT][/I] [LIST] [*][FONT=Verdana]Stat Generation: roll 3d6 6 times, take highest 4 scores, assign to STR, AGI, MIND and CHA as you wish (suggestion: use Invisible Castle to roll 6x 3d6 and discard 2 lowest scores)[/FONT] [*][FONT=Verdana]Starting Level is 3000XP (Level 1 Elf, Level 2 Dwarf/Fighter/Halfling/Magic-User, Level 3 Thief/Cleric)[/FONT] [*][FONT=Verdana]Characters can be equipped with the 'standard' equipment consisting of pack A, B or C plus their class equipment or can be equipped 'from scratch' with 120 + 3d6x5 GP[/FONT] [/LIST] [FONT=Verdana]Deities shamelessly cribbed from 3rd ed PHB:[/FONT] [FONT=Verdana]Pelor (Sun, light, life), Boccob (Magic, knowledge, lore), Olidamarra (Luck, rogues, fortune), the three deities chiefly worshipped by humans[/FONT] [FONT=Verdana]Corellon, god of elves[/FONT] [FONT=Verdana]Moradin, god of dwarves[/FONT] [FONT=Verdana]Yondalla, goddess of halflings[/FONT] [/QUOTE]
